DESCRIPTION
The PP valves are push‑pull manually operable on‑off air
control valves with an exhaust function. Most are pressure
sensitive, so that they will automatically move from the
applied to the exhaust position as supply pressure is
reduced to a certain minimum, depending on the
spring installed. The exception to this is the BendixeBay logo®
PP‑8 ™ valve and some Bendix ® PP‑1 ® valves which
do not contain a spring. The PP‑8 valve also has a
larger diameter shaft for button mounting so that when
installed on the same panel with other PP valves the
buttons cannot be inadvertently mixed. The PP-8 valve is
normally used to operate tractor spring brakes independently
from the trailer.
The Bendix® PP‑5™ valve is unique in having an auxiliary
piston in the lower cover which, upon receiving a pneumatic
signal of 18 psi or more, will cause the valve to move
from the applied to the exhaust position from a 100 psi
application.

The Bendix® PP‑2™ valve has an auxiliary port which
may be plumbed into a service brake line to release the
spring brakes if a service application is made, preventing
compounding of forces on the foundation brakes.

The BendixeBay logo® RD‑3™ valve differs slightly in that it normally
remains in the exhaust position and requires a constant
manual force to hold it in the applied position.

PREVENTIVE MAINTENANCE
Important: Review the Bendix Warranty Policy before
performing any intrusive maintenance procedures. A
warranty may be voided if intrusive maintenance is
performed during the warranty period.
No two vehicles operate under identical conditions, as
a result, maintenance intervals may vary. Experience is
a valuable guide in determining the best maintenance
interval for air brake system components. At a minimum,
the PP valves should be inspected every 6 months or
1500 operating hours, whichever comes first, for proper
operation. Should the PP valves not meet the elements
of the operational tests noted in this document, further
investigation and service of the valve may be required.

BENDIX® PP-1®, PP-8™, & RD-3™ VALVES
1. Run the vehicle until the air system reaches full
reservoir pressure (120-135 psi). Turn off the vehicle.
2. Move the control valve button & plunger from side to
side and up and down. Do not push the button in. If
there is any play, or if audible leakage is detected, the
valve must be replaced.

BENDIX® PP-2™ VALVE
1. Proceed as for the PP-1 valve through Step 1.
2. With the button pulled out (exhaust position), leakage
at the brake valve port or at the plunger stem should
not exceed a 1-in. bubble in five (5) seconds.
3. Push the button in. Supply pressure should be present
in the delivery volume. Leakage at the exhaust port
or around the plunger stem should not exceed a 1-in.
bubble in five (5) seconds.
4. Pull the button out and apply supply pressure at the
brake valve port. Supply pressure should be present
in the delivery volume and leakage at the exhaust port
should not exceed a 1-in. bubble in five (5) seconds.
NOTE: If any of the above push-pull valves do not
function as described or if leakage is excessive,
it is recommended they be returned to our
nearest authorized distributor for a service new or
remanufactured replacement.

3. Identify the dash valve exhaust hose location – if there
is a hose still connected to the Park Control Valve
Exhaust Port, it is advised to disconnect it and remove
any fitting.
4. With the button pulled out (exhaust position), rotate the
button and plunger in a clockwise direction – stopping
every 90º to check for leakage.
5. Using a soap solution, check for leaks. The allowable
leakage should not exceed a 1” bubble in 5 seconds
at any location on the valve.
6. Push the button in (applied position) and check for
leaks. (The Bendix® RD-3™ valve will have to be
manually held in this position.) The leakage should
not exceed a 1” bubble in 3 seconds at any location
on the valve.
7. Reduce the supply pressure. At a pressure from 60
to 20 psi, depending on the part number specific
automatic release pressure, the button should pop out
automatically, exhausting the delivery volume. (This
does not apply to the RD-3, PP-8 or some PP-1 valves
without an automatic release pressure).
